How they compare

Africa currently reports 258,640 t against 102,005 t in Canada, a difference of 156,635 t.

That makes Africa's figure about 2.5 times Canada's.

Across all 35 years both countries report, Africa has been ahead every year.

Africa ranks 9th and Canada ranks 6th of 25 groups.

Africa has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Africa Canada Difference Ahead
1990s 66,924 t 33,840 t 33,084 t Africa
2000s 93,070 t 41,063 t 52,008 t Africa
2010s 165,770 t 78,571 t 87,198 t Africa
2020s 242,900 t 98,061 t 144,839 t Africa

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ains statistics on the agricultural use of major pesticide groups and of relevant chemical families. Data are disseminated by country, with global coverage and are updated annually. The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ains information on the use of major pesticide groups:1. Insecticides (Chlorinated hydrocarbons, Organo-phosphates, Carbamates-insecticides, Pyrethroids, Botanical and biological products and Others not elsewhere classified);2. Mineral Oils;3. Herbicides (Phenoxy hormone products, Triazines, Amides, Carbamates-herbicides, Dinitroanilines, Urea derivatives, Sulfonyl urea, Bipiridils, Uracil, Others not elsewhere classified);4. Fungicides and Bactericides (Inorganic, Dithiocarbamates, Benzimidazoles, Triazoles, Diazoles, Diazines, Morpholines, Others not elsewhere classified);5. Plant Growth Regulators;6. Rodenticides (Anti-coagulants, Cyanide Generators, Hypercalcaemics, Narcotics, Others not elsewhere classified);7. Other Pesticides NES (not elsewhere specified).
